Five things to know if you are serving alcohol at your wedding

If you're planning to serve alcohol at your wedding, there are several important things you need to know to ensure that everything goes smoothly. From legal requirements to practical considerations, here are five essential things to keep in mind:

  1. Check Local Laws and Regulations

Before you even begin planning your wedding, it's crucial to research local laws and regulations regarding alcohol service. Depending on your location, there may be restrictions on the types of alcohol you can serve, the hours during which you can serve it, and the licensing and insurance requirements you need to meet. Make sure you understand these regulations and factor them into your plans.

2. Hire a Professional Bartender or Caterer

Unless you're planning a very small and casual wedding, it's usually best to hire a professional bartender or catering company to handle alcohol service. Not only will they be experienced in serving large crowds, but they'll also have the necessary licenses, insurance, and equipment to ensure that everything is safe and legal. Additionally, they'll be able to help you choose the right types and amounts of alcohol to serve based on your budget and guest preferences.

3. Offer Non-Alcoholic Options

While alcohol is often a big part of wedding celebrations, it's important to remember that not everyone drinks or wants to drink. To be inclusive of all your guests, make sure you offer a variety of non-alcoholic options, such as soda, juice, and water. You could also consider serving mocktails or other creative alcohol-free drinks that everyone can enjoy.

4. Plan for Transportation and Accommodations

One of the biggest risks associated with alcohol service at weddings is drunk driving. To help mitigate this risk, consider arranging for transportation options for your guests, such as a shuttle or ride-sharing service. You could also offer accommodations for guests who need a place to stay overnight, such as booking a block of rooms at a nearby hotel.

5. Set Clear Limits and Expectations

Finally, it's important to set clear limits and expectations for alcohol service at your wedding. This includes things like establishing a last call time, providing plenty of food to help guests pace themselves, and designating someone to monitor guests' alcohol consumption and intervene if necessary. By setting these expectations upfront, you can help ensure that everyone has a fun and safe time at your wedding.

In summary, serving alcohol at a wedding can be a great way to celebrate, but it requires careful planning and consideration. By following these five tips, you can help ensure that your wedding is a memorable and enjoyable experience for all your guests.
